Default Teraflex 9550 shocks?

anyone have em? like em? reccomend em? I might pick some up but lets see what u guys think

I have them on my rig with the 2.5" Teraflex coil kit. They ride a little bit stiffer than my old Rubi shocks, but really work well rock crawling. Seem to be good onroad too even at 70-80 mph. I am even running without a steering stabilizer right now and it handles great.

I have them on my 2011...and honestly don't notice a difference from the stock Sport shocks (Front Shocks - 68028415AB, Rear Shocks - 68028455AB). Both were stiff from the get go!

2.5 TF lift with the shocks and I like them. Well over 30,000 kms and they still perform as they did new. Yes, as others state they run a little stiff but nothing major. I don't off road but driving on Montreal roads will abuse the heck outta any shock so seeing as how they holding up, that says it all IMO
